02 · Price Reference

Water heater replacement cost by type.

Installed prices for Moody, adjusted for local labor. Larger tanks and code upgrades move the number up.

  • 01
    Tank, 40–50 gal gas
    The default for most US homes
    $700 – $1,750
  • 02
    Tank, 40–50 gal electric
    No venting required
    $800 – $1,950
  • 03
    Tankless, gas
    Endless hot water, higher BTU gas line often needed
    $1,300 – $3,100+
  • 04
    Hybrid heat pump
    Most efficient, qualifies for federal credits
    $1,600 – $3,500
  • 05
    Permit & disposal
    Most jurisdictions require it
    $45 – $275

Why Water Heater Replacement Costs Vary in Moody

Several factors unique to Moody and Alabama influence the cost of replacing a water heater. The local climate—hot, humid summers and occasional winter freezes—can accelerate corrosion and shorten unit lifespan, especially for tanks in unconditioned spaces. Many Moody homes have hard water, which leads to sediment buildup and more frequent replacements. The age of your home matters: older houses may require updates to meet current Alabama code, such as expansion tanks or seismic straps. Labor rates in the Moody area reflect the local cost of living and demand for skilled plumbers. Finally, permit fees and inspection requirements from the city's permitting office add a small but necessary expense.

Common Water Heater Issues in Moody Homes

  1. 1

    Sediment Buildup from Hard Water

    Alabama's mineral-rich water causes sediment to accumulate at the bottom of tanks, reducing efficiency and leading to early failure. This is especially common in Moody homes with well water.

  2. 2

    Corrosion from Humidity

    High humidity levels in Moody can cause external rust on tank water heaters, particularly those installed in basements or crawl spaces without proper ventilation.

  3. 3

    Freeze Damage in Winter

    Though winters are mild, occasional hard freezes can damage water heaters in uninsulated garages or outdoor enclosures. Burst pipes and cracked tanks are a risk.

  4. 4

    Old Age of Original Units

    Many Moody homes built in the 1990s still have their original water heaters. These units are past their expected lifespan and prone to leaks or failure.

  5. 5

    Improper Sizing for Family Needs

    As families grow or lifestyles change, the original water heater may be undersized. This leads to running out of hot water during peak usage times.

Q · 03

What are the Alabama licensing requirements for plumbers?

In Alabama, plumbers must be licensed by the Alabama Board of Plumbing Examiners. This ensures they have passed exams and meet experience requirements. Always verify that your plumber holds a current Alabama license. For water heater replacement, the plumber should also pull a permit with the local building department to ensure the work meets code.

Q · 04

When is the best time to replace a water heater in Moody?

Plan replacement before your unit fails, ideally during mild weather in spring or fall. Emergency replacements in winter (due to freeze damage) or summer (high demand) can be more expensive and harder to schedule. If your water heater is over 10 years old, consider proactive replacement to avoid leaks and water damage.
